WebSep 7, 2024 · 1 quart oil (4 cups, 1 liter), vegetable or olive oil 4.2 oz. pickling salt (120grams) 17.6 oz. granulated sugar (500grams) Seasonings per 1 Quart (700ml to 1000ml) Jar 1 whole bay leaf 2 allspice berries 2 whole black pepper berries 2 thick onion slices 1 sliced garlic clover (optional) 1/8 tsp chili flakes (optional) Instructions WebJan 5, 2024 · Cut the stem ends off; slice the remaining chiles into thin rings. Place the chiles in a small saucepan; add enough oil to just barely come to the top of the chile rings. Heat the oil; simmer for 1 minute. Turn the heat off, cover and let stand for at least 30 minutes or up to 5 or 6 hours. Pour into a glass jar with a tight-fitting lid.

WebJul 7, 2016 · Directions: In a saucepan over medium heat, combine vinegar, salt, brown sugar, oregano, garlic cloves and olive oil and bring to a simmer. Add sliced peppers and simmer for 10 to 15 minutes until the peppers are tender. Transfer peppers into a pint mason jar and pour the liquid over top; secure with airtight lid and refrigerate overnight to ... WebAug 10, 2024 · Slice the top 1/4-inch off a head of garlic.
